Output 68e948a6b36dccc8cfd38e2e6518c151ce46eed64c4cb63d595d194439d0c039:1
- value
- 18346249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ab9fae9d494566b1c783175ef2b9fc54df2adbe OP_EQUAL
- address
- 38W8is8pVXXuxyzpPS2fzwEArFYDGECjya
- transaction
- 68e948a6b36dccc8cfd38e2e6518c151ce46eed64c4cb63d595d194439d0c039
- confirmations
- 285982
- spent
- true